Strength and Speed
DEWALT-designed electronics have been built into the DCD780C2’s switch to provide maximum life for the tool and battery by helping to protect them from overheating, overloading, and deep discharge during use. The 20-volt’s lithium-ion batteries provide up to 35 percent more runtime than existing 18-volt lithium-ion battery technology. The included charger has dual voltage capabilities, and it is compatible with both 12-volt max and 20-volt max DEWALT lithium-ion batteries; the DCD780C2 is also compatible with the 3.0 Ah lithium-ion batters that are available as replacement packs or come with the premium tools. Plus, the drill’s high-power, high-efficiency motor delivers 350 unit watts out of maximum power for superior performance in light and medium drilling applications. A 1/2-inch ratcheting chuck with carbide inserts provides superior bit-gripping strength—reducing slippage during high-torque applications—thus providing longer tool life. The drill/driver’s two-speed (0-600 RPM and 0-2,000 RPM) transmission allows users to select the appropriate speed for the job at hand and is up to 30 percent faster than current drill/drivers on the market.


Comfort and Convenience
The compact drill’s design incorporates a slim handle with contoured grip that extends user comfort during long jobs, and DEWALT’s engineering and design team adjusted the product footprint and weight allocation for ideal balance and a lightweight feel, making the 3.4-pound tool easy to maneuver in tight areas. Its 7.5-inch length is half an inch shorter than other currently available drill/drivers. The bright built-in LED work light above the trigger has a 20-second delay that improves visibility in dimly lit spaces.

What's in the Box
One DEWALT DCD780C2 20-volt max lithium-ion compact 1.5 Ah drill/driver kit, including one 1/2-inch drill/driver, two 20-volt max 1.5 Ah lithium-ion batteries, one 30-minute fast charger, one belt hook, one on-board bit holder, and one hard plastic storage and carrying case.

This is amazingly powerful for such a small tool. Very light and easy to use. It fits into much smaller spaces than the drill it replaced. Like most of the drills I've used though, it's clutch is not to be trusted. During assembly of several face frames using this tool with a Kreg jig, the drill started overtightening and stripping the screws. At the time of failure, the clutch was set at 10 and I had already tightened about 20 screws with no problems. Oh well, I'll go back to snugging the screws with the driver and hand tightening the rest of the way. I just thought I would see if this drill had a more dependable clutch than past drills. It doesn't. If it lasts, I'll still consider this a good purchase.
